EBV Quantitative PCR

Test Summary

Detection of EBV DNA via real-time qualitative PCR

Specimen Collection

Special Instructions

N/A

Preferred Specimen

2 mL EDTA Plasma (Lavender top) tube(s)

Minimum Volume

0.5 mL plasma
0.5 mL whole blood

Instructions

Centrifuge the tube for at least 10 minutes. Transfer plasma to a completely labeled plastic transport tube within 6 hours of collection. Freeze plasma pour off.

Transport Temperature

Plasma - Frozen or Refrigerated
Whole Blood - Refrigerated

Specimen Stability

  • Plasma
  • Room Temperature = unacceptable
  • Refrigerated = 8 hours (24 hours after first thaw)
  • Frozen = 5 days
  • Whole Blood
  • Room Temperature = 8 hours
  • Refrigerated = 5 days
  • Frozen = unacceptable

Methodology

This test employs a Real Time Polymerase Chain Reaction (PCR) for the amplification of a well conserved region of EBV LMP2A Gene.
